## Field derivation

The form's structure, reconstructed by row (English-only, verified via
`getTextContent()` positions):

**Page 1** — header (Ghana Revenue Authority, Domestic Tax Revenue Division,
Personal Income Tax Return; Current Tax Office LTO/MTO/STO tick-one + Name
of GRA Office; Year of Assessment; Period From/To dd/mm); §1 Personal
Information (Surname/TIN, First Name/Telephone No., Other Name(s),
Nationality); §2 Business Information (Location/GhanaPost Digital Address;
Business Name(s)/Business Activity; "If more than ONE provide the same
information on a separate sheet"; Tenancy status of Business
Rented/Owned + "(If rented provide particulars of Landlord)"; Name of
Landlord; Telephone Number(s); TIN); §3 Employment Information (TIN of
Employer, Name of Employer, Address).

**Page 2** — §4 Sources of Income: "(Do you earn income from business? If
No proceed to B)"; A. Net Business Income/Loss (As per financial Statement
attached); "(Do you earn income from employment? If No proceed to C)"; B.
Employment Income (i. Basic salary, ii. Cash Allowances, iii. Other Cash
Benefit, iv. Excess Bonus, Benefit in Kind [1. Accommodation Benefit, 2.
Vehicle Benefit, 3. Others e.g. Loan Benefit & Share Benefit etc.], v.
Total Benefits in kind, **vii.** Others (e.g. Director's Fees), TOTAL
EMPLOYMENT INCOME (Sum i to vi)); "Do you any investment income? (If No
proceed to D)"; C. Investment and Other Incomes (i. Royalty, ii. Interest,
iii. Dividend (Received from Non-Resident Person), iv. Taxable Rent Income,
v. Income from Foreign Source, vi. Other, TOTAL INVESTMENT INCOME & OTHER
INCOMES); D. TOTAL INCOME.

**Page 3** — §5 Tax Computation: A. Net Business Profit/Loss (Same as 4A);
Add Backs (i. Depreciation, ii. Non-allowable deductions); B. Total Add
Backs; C. Adjusted Business Profit/Loss; Deduct (i. Non-Taxable income, ii.
Allowable Deduction); D. Total Deductions; E. Net Adjusted Business
Profit/Loss; F. Add Total Investment Income (same as 4C); G. Add Total
Employment Income (same as 4B); H. Total Assessable Income; I. Income Taxed
at Different Rates; J. Net Assessable Income; Deduct: Reliefs (i. Social
Security, ii. Marriage/Responsibility, iii. Children's education, iv. Old
Age, v. Aged Dependents, vi. Disability, vii. Cost of Training, viii.
Voluntary Pension contribution, **x.** Other allowable deductions); K.
Total allowable deductions/reliefs (Sum of i to ix).

**Page 4** — L. Chargeable Income (5J – 5K); M. Tax Charged; Less Payments
(i. Tax Credits, ii. Payment on Account (All Sources)); N. Total Payments;
O. Tax Payable/(Overpaid); DECLARATION — a. For persons making return on
their own behalf ("I, ___ do hereby declare..."; Signature/Date; "OR" /
"R.T.P"); b. For persons making return on behalf of another person ("I ___
on behalf of ___ do hereby declare..."; Address; Signature; Relationship to
taxpayer; Date).

## Disclosed source-form artifacts (not silently corrected)

Two apparent stale-caption artifacts in the source PDF itself, each modeled
verbatim rather than corrected, consistent with this registry's established
precedent (e.g. `gr/aade`'s own disclosed code-to-label ambiguities) of
modeling what the source actually prints:

1. **§4B employment-income breakdown:** the printed item list runs i–v then
   jumps directly to **"vii. Others (e.g. Director's Fees)"** — no "vi"
   item is printed anywhere in the extracted text — while the section's own
   total caption still reads **"TOTAL EMPLOYMENT INCOME (Sum i to vi)"**.
   Modeled as `employmentOtherIncome` (item vii) and `totalEmploymentIncome`
   (the caption's own mismatch disclosed on the latter field's
   `description`).
2. **§5 Reliefs:** the printed item list runs i–viii then jumps directly to
   **"x. Other allowable deductions"** — no "ix" item is printed — while its
   own total caption reads **"K. Total allowable deductions/reliefs (Sum of
   i to ix)"**. Modeled as `reliefOtherAllowableDeductions` (item x) and
   `totalAllowableDeductionsReliefs` (the same kind of disclosed mismatch).
